The trick to de-icing a freezer in a few minutes effortlessly

To get faster, you can soak a sponge of hot water and rub the walls of the freezer to soften the ice.

It is also possible to fill a hot water spray bottle to spray it onto the walls for melting. Using a wooden spatula, drop the frost that starts to soften.

On the other hand, if the layer of ice is thick, it is advisable to use boiling water. To do this, boil water in a saucepan and place it in your freezer, taking care to place it on a bribe.
Then close the device and leave to act for about 10 minutes. Finally, using a wooden spatula, detach the blocks of ice that are beginning to melt.

What to do after defrosting the freezer?
After de-icing your freezer, it is important to clean it and disinfect it, in order to eliminate the bacteria that cause bad odours.

To do this, mix in three volumes of water, a volume of lemon juice and a volume of white vinegar. Imbe a microfiber cloth of this solution and pass it over the walls of the freezer to disinfect them and remove dirt but also to deodorize your household appliance.

Also consider cleaning the various accessories in your freezer such as the compartments. Then, properly dry your appliance with a clean cloth, without rinsing, to avoid moisture causing the formation of frost.

Take advantage of the cleaning of your freezer to check the condition of the gaskets to ensure that your freezer is properly sealed. After cleaning your freezer, all you have to do is turn it on again.
